The used Doosan DBC 130L II is a large-capacity CNC horizontal table-type boring mill designed for machining extremely large and heavy components with high precision. It is an extended-bed (“L” version) variant of the DBC 130 II series, offering longer X-axis travel for oversized workpieces.
This machine features a 130 mm spindle, a heavy-duty rotary table with full B-axis indexing, and long axis travels that allow multi-face machining in a single setup. Its rigid construction and quill-type spindle design make it ideal for deep boring, milling, drilling, and tapping operations in demanding industrial environments.
When purchasing a used DBC 130L II, key inspection areas include spindle wear, rotary table backlash, axis accuracy over long travels, and tool changer performance, as these machines are typically used for heavy-duty production.
DOOSAN DBC 130L IISPECIFICATIONS
DOOSAN DBC 130L II – AXIS TRAVELS
X-Axis Travel: 4000 mm
Y-Axis Travel: 2500 mm
Z-Axis Travel: 2000 mm
W-Axis (Quill): ~600–700 mm
B-Axis: 360° Rotary Table

DOOSAN DBC 130L II – SPINDLE
Spindle Diameter: 130 mm
Max Spindle Speed: 2,500–3,000 RPM
Spindle Taper: CAT 50 / BT50
Motor Power: ~26 kW (~35 HP)
Torque: ~3300+ Nm

WHY BUY USED DOOSAN DBC 130L II
Buying a used Doosan DBC 130L II is ideal for shops that need extended travel capacity for large components.
The biggest advantage of the “L” version is its longer X-axis travel, allowing machining of very large parts without repositioning. The rotary table further enhances productivity by enabling multi-side machining in one setup.
Its high torque spindle and rigid construction make it suitable for heavy cutting applications, especially in large castings and steel structures.
HOW MUCH DOES A USED DOOSAN DBC 130L IICOST?
Pricing depends on year, condition, tooling, and installed options.
Typical pricing ranges:
2012–2016 models: around $180,000 to $300,000
2016–2020 models: around $250,000 to $400,000
Well-equipped machines: can exceed $450,000
Machines with pallet changers, large tool magazines, and high-pressure coolant systems will command higher prices.
